1What is the typical cost range for professional cabinet installation in West Milton, and what factors influence the price?

In West Milton and the surrounding Susquehanna Valley, professional cabinet installation typically ranges from $1,500 to $5,000+, heavily dependent on project scope and cabinet quality. Key cost factors include the linear footage of cabinets, the complexity of the layout (e.g., corners, islands), and whether you are installing stock, semi-custom, or custom cabinetry. Local material and labor costs also play a role, and we always recommend getting itemized quotes from local installers to understand the breakdown for your specific project.

2How does Pennsylvania's humid summer climate affect cabinet installation and material choice?

Pennsylvania's significant humidity swings, especially in the Susquehanna River valley, can cause wood to expand and contract. We recommend choosing cabinetry constructed with stable materials and proper sealing, and allowing delivered cabinets to acclimate inside your West Milton home for 48-72 hours before installation. Proper installation also includes ensuring adequate expansion gaps and using climate-appropriate adhesives to prevent warping or joint failure over time.

3Do I need a permit for a cabinet installation project in West Milton, PA?

For a straightforward cabinet replacement where the layout and plumbing/electrical are not changing, a permit is usually not required in West Milton. However, if your project involves moving plumbing lines for a sink, altering gas lines for a cooktop, or significantly reconfiguring walls, you will likely need permits from the local municipality. A reputable local installer will know when permits are necessary and can often help guide you through the process.

4What should I look for when choosing a cabinet installer in the West Milton area?

Prioritize local installers with verifiable references and physical addresses, as they understand regional supplier lead times and climate considerations. Check for proper licensing and insurance (general liability and workers' compensation are crucial), and look for membership in state or national trade associations. Always ask to see photos of recent local projects and inquire about their experience with the specific cabinet brand or type you have purchased.

5What is a realistic timeline from ordering to completed installation for a kitchen in West Milton?

The timeline varies dramatically. For in-stock cabinets, installation can often be scheduled within 1-3 weeks. For semi-custom or custom orders, lead times from manufacturers can be 8-16 weeks, which is common across Pennsylvania due to high demand. The actual installation for an average kitchen typically takes 2-4 days for a professional crew. Always plan for potential delays in the winter months due to weather impacting material deliveries to our region.
